Water of Love

My new release next week, SEAL Of Time, part of the Trident Legacy duet with Kathryn LeVeque, is about a hero who is a son of Poseidon. I had a great time with all the water images that came to mind as I was writing this novella.

The fact that Tay Demmett is a Navy SEAL, a medic, with special powers from his father, is perfect as a cover for this immortal hero. He has to be comfortable in the water as a SEAL, but hides the fact that he can travel at near supersonic speeds.

And what fun it was to write the underwater sex scene with his heroine, who, of course, is a human.

I loved the images of water being relentless, working its way into cracks and fissures of the earth. In this case, Tay’s mother being mortal, is symbolized by the earth goddess image. Water wears away earth, transforms the landscape, gives and takes from her. The earth, on the other hand, holds and restrains water. She becomes the passage the water travels through, the vessel.

I don’t often get these sorts of images when I write, since I don’t write straight fantasy, but doing my first paranormal SEAL, I loved how this theme worked well. Our heroes often are attracted to that which they cannot have sometimes, until they transform and become worthy. The partnership of water and earth goes back in history to a time even before there was romance!

NYT and USA/Today Bestselling Author Sharon Hamilton's SEAL Brotherhood series have earned her author rankings of #1 in Romantic Suspense, Military Romance and Contemporary Romance. Her other Brotherhood stand-alone series are: Bad Boys of SEAL Team 3, Band of Bachelors, True Blue SEALs, Nashville SEALs, Bone Frog Brotherhood, Sunset SEALs, Bone Frog Bachelor Series and SEAL Brotherhood Legacy Series. She is a contributing author to the very popular Shadow SEALs multi-author series. Her SEALs and former SEALs have invested in two wineries, a lavender farm and a brewery in Sonoma County, which have become part of the new stories. They also have expanded to include Veteran-benefit projects on the Florida Gulf Coast, as well as projects in Africa and the Maldives. One of the SEAL wives has even launched her own women's fiction series. But old characters, as well as children of these SEAL heroes keep returning to all the newer books. Sharon also writes sexy paranormals in two series: Golden Vampires of Tuscany and The Guardians. A lifelong organic vegetable and flower gardener, Sharon and her husband lived for fifty years in the Wine Country of Northern California, where many of her stories take place. Recently, they have moved to the beautiful Gulf Coast of Florida, with stories of shipwrecks, the white sugar-sand beaches of Sunset, Treasure Island and Indian Rocks Beaches.
